Hand-colored postcard of the Skinner Memorial Chapel viewed from First St. at Carleton College. Handwritten text on back reads in part "Big day today - not much study. International Club meeting, fine Chamber Music recital here, then St. Olaf's Christmas music tonight... one of the girl's dorms caught fire tonight! So big excitement no?" Card is postmarked Dec 1943 and is from Hazel Ramsay, Assistant Professor of History at Carleton College 1943-44.

Student body gathered in Hoyme Chapel (destroyed by fire in 1923), picture taken from pulpit of chapel. Note that girls and boys are seated in separate sections and men have their hats off while women kept theirs on. See http://www.stolaf.edu/president/enewsletter/archives.html (October 2003)
